Admissions criteria - Bachelor of Health Care, Paramedic Nurse, full-time studies, Lappeenranta


Eligibility criteria

Eligibility to apply for bachelor’s degree programme in Paramedic depends on having completed at least one of the following:

  • the Finnish matriculation examination
  • an International Baccalaureate (IB) diploma
  • a European Baccalaureate (EB) diploma
  • a Reifeprüfung (RP) diploma or Deutsche Internationale Abitur (DIA) diploma completed in Finland
  • a Finnish vocational qualification of three years (ammatillinen perustutkinto) in duration completed after 1.8.2015.

The selection will be made on the basis of the above-mentioned diplomas only, and there is no entrance examination. A Finnish vocational upper secondary qualifications completed after 1.8.2015 are taken into account in certificate-based selection. NB: Competence-based qualifications are not taken into account in certificate-based selection.

The student must be at least 18 years old when starting the studies i.e., the student must turn eighteen by the end of August 2025.

Required degree certificates

When filling in the application form at Studyinfo.fi, in certain cases you will need to attach a copy of your certificate in order to be considered for the certificate-based selection. The following certificates have to be uploaded to your application by 29 January 2025 at 3:00 pm Finnish time (UTC+3)

  • Finnish Matriculation examination completed before year 1990
  • International Baccalaureate (IB) diploma, European Baccalaureate (EB) diploma or Reiferprüfung (RP)/ Deutsches Internationales Abitur (DIA) diploma
  • Finnish Vocational upper secondary qualification completed 1.8.2015 - 31.12.2016
  • Finnish vocational upper secondary qualification completed in Åland

Grades for matriculation examination taken after 1990 are obtained directly from the YTL. Certificate-based selection of vocational upper secondary qualifications of the year 2017 and later is conducted on the basis of data in KOSKI service.

If an applicant has completed the vocational qualification before 1.8.2015, the qualification will not be taken into account in the certificate-based selection and the applicant will not be eligible for selection.


Exemption from tuition fee (Does not apply to Finnish or EU/EEA citizens)

Attach a copy of your passport or residence permit card to Finland if you are applying for the exemption of tuition fee on the basis of your nationality or residence permit.

  • Passport or identity card to indicate the citizenship of EU/EEA/Switzerland*
  • Continuous residence permit card in Finland, Type A permit issued for other than study purposes or
  • Permanent residence permit card in Finland, Type P permit or
  • EU residence permit for third-country citizens with long-term residence card in Finland (Type P-EU) or
  • EU Blue Card in Finland or
  • EU Family Member's Residence Card in Finland
  • Proof from the Finnish Immigration Services that the student has registered, or applied for registration for EU right to residence in Finland (UK-citizens) or

Brexit residence permit card, Type TEU agreement's 50 article = Right of residence under the withdrawal agreement, or P TEU-agreement's 50 article = Right of permanent residence under the withdrawal agreement

*Citizens of Finland are not required to provide proof of their citizenship as it will be verified from the population register.

Please notice: if you receive one of the documents mentioned above at any point of the admission process, please provide us the document as soon as possible. The residence permit must be valid on 1.8.2025.
